We recently purchased a smoker and were so excited to smoke some meat on the upcoming weekend. We decided on buying meat from a butcher to smoke. Looked up nearby places on the internet, and the only one open near us was Top Choice Meats. They received great reviews, so we decided to give them a shot. They're located in a strip mall with plenty of parking available. We were greeted as we walked in (always a good sign). The inside was very clean and organized. The young lady who helped us was super helpful and knowledgeable with all questions asked. We decided on a brisket, but the one in the case was around 8 lbs, which was way too big for just the two of us. She offered to cut it in half. Perfect! We got home, made a rub, and smoked it for about 4 hrs on 250°. Once the internal temperature reached 195°, we removed it to let it rest for about an hour. We sliced it and wow, oh wow, it was outstanding! The flavor of the meat was amazing. We were very happy with our first smoke.
